Transaction cd0892dcfb540ac440f2d159a4d36dea5eae1eb72c9134369bc22d56d85ad5b7

70 Input
1 Outputs
  • cd0892dcfb540ac440f2d159a4d36dea5eae1eb72c9134369bc22d56d85ad5b7:0
  • value  49223957
    address  3CPisSDbmxx6Ce9KRFKmQMzR7xbJevVm2V